import { AudioStream, VideoStream } from '../types';
import { CodecParseResult } from './CodecUtils';
/**
* Format sorting preferences configuration
*/
export interface FormatSorterConfig {
preferHighQuality?: boolean;
preferHighFramerate?: boolean;
preferHDR?: boolean;
preferModernCodecs?: boolean;
preferredVideoCodecs?: string[];
preferredAudioCodecs?: string[];
preferredContainers?: string[];
preferUnencrypted?: boolean;
preferDash?: boolean;
preferProgressive?: boolean;
preferredLanguages?: string[];
targetPlatform?: 'web' | 'mobile' | 'desktop' | 'smart_tv';
customSortFields?: string[];
}
/**
* Extended stream info for sorting
*/
interface ExtendedStreamInfo {
stream: AudioStream | VideoStream;
codecInfo: CodecParseResult;
qualityScore: number;
codecScore: number;
containerScore: number;
hdrScore: number;
encryptionPenalty: number;
platformCompatibility: number;
languageScore: number;
totalScore: number;
}
/**
* Advanced Format Sorter class based on yt-dlp methodology
*/
export declare class FormatSorter {
private config;
private static readonly CODEC_RANKINGS;
private static readonly CONTAINER_RANKINGS;
constructor(config?: FormatSorterConfig);
/**
* Sort audio streams by quality and preferences
*/
sortAudioStreams(streams: AudioStream[]): AudioStream[];
/**
* Sort video streams by quality and preferences
*/
sortVideoStreams(streams: VideoStream[]): VideoStream[];
/**
* Get the best audio stream based on quality analysis
*/
getBestAudioStream(streams: AudioStream[]): AudioStream | null;
/**
* Get the best video stream based on quality analysis
*/
getBestVideoStream(streams: VideoStream[]): VideoStream | null;
/**
* Analyze audio stream and calculate comprehensive scores
*/
private analyzeAudioStream;
/**
* Analyze video stream and calculate comprehensive scores
*/
private analyzeVideoStream;
/**
* Extract codec information from stream
*/
private getCodecInfo;
/**
* Calculate audio quality score based on bitrate, sample rate, etc.
*/
private calculateAudioQualityScore;
/**
* Calculate video quality score based on resolution, bitrate, fps, etc.
*/
private calculateVideoQualityScore;
/**
* Calculate codec quality score
*/
private calculateCodecScore;
/**
* Calculate container format score
*/
private calculateContainerScore;
/**
* Calculate HDR bonus score
*/
private calculateHDRScore;
/**
* Calculate encryption penalty
*/
private calculateEncryptionPenalty;
/**
* Calculate platform compatibility score
*/
private calculatePlatformCompatibility;
/**
* Calculate language preference score
*/
private calculateLanguageScore;
/**
* Check web browser compatibility
*/
private isWebCompatible;
/**
* Check mobile device compatibility
*/
private isMobileCompatible;
/**
* Check smart TV compatibility
*/
private isSmartTVCompatible;
/**
* Get detailed format analysis for debugging
*/
getFormatAnalysis(stream: AudioStream | VideoStream): ExtendedStreamInfo;
/**
* Update sorting configuration
*/
updateConfig(newConfig: Partial<FormatSorterConfig>): void;
/**
* Get current configuration
*/
getConfig(): FormatSorterConfig;
}
/**
* Create a format sorter with predefined configurations for common use cases
*/
export declare class FormatSorterPresets {
/**
* High quality preset - prefer best codecs and highest quality
*/
static createHighQualityPreset(): FormatSorter;
/**
* Web compatibility preset - prefer formats that work well in browsers
*/
static createWebCompatibilityPreset(): FormatSorter;
/**
* Mobile preset - prefer formats that work well on mobile devices
*/
static createMobilePreset(): FormatSorter;
/**
* Bandwidth optimized preset - prefer smaller file sizes
*/
static createBandwidthOptimizedPreset(): FormatSorter;
}
export {};
